One of the reasons that ADS never made it onto the chart was that, at least at one time, Grant was buying them without the BCG and swapping in a better quality one. So, do I put the stock ADS rifle specs on the chart, or do I put the G&R version? And no matter which version I put, I'd have to explain it.
Since they are a relatively small player, I simply choose to leave them off. If they ramp up and start appearing more often, I'll rethink including them.

ADS rifles are now being shipped with carriers that are properly staked, black extractor inserts and Crane O-rings.
In the past I would strip the carriers and make these improvements myself, but they are now shipping from the factory good to go.

Originally Posted By BravoCompanyUSA:
With the continuing production of BCM barrels a very very large percentage of BCM bolts get HPT also (some runs 100%). (all get MPI) It is a our policy not to advertise any type of batch testing as a specific feature. When we have lines running to specifically proof 100%, then we would say HPT also in our text. Our ad copy is very conservative in its listing of features.
As a note: We have scrapped bolts, but have yet to have a MPI failure from HPT.
